Cancer, emotions and mental illness: the present state of understanding
FG Surawicz, DR Brightwell, WD Weitzel and E Othmer
The authors review recent and current literature on the relationship
between psychological factors and cancer. They discuss the roles of
predisposing personality patterns and emotional stress in the development,
site, and course of cancer; the influence of awareness of terminal illness
on the behavior of cancer patients; and the management of psychiatric
symptoms in these patients.
